This show featured the first ever class for ‘Texting While Trotting.’ Mary, Alex, and Savannah were brave enough to enter the competition on Hooper, Dexter, and Hugo. (We will admit that they practiced in their group lessons on Thursday nights!)
These three entered the ring to find a class of seven competitors. After texting at the trot, only the top five could continue to the cantering round. The top two texter/riders advanced to the ride off, and Savannah made the cut to represent Team Knollwood.
After the final text, Savannah was declared the winner on Hugo!
